Google doesn't care how pretty your website is. A gorgeous design with a searchability score of zero is nothing more than an expensive digital brochure sitting in a dark corner of the internet where nobody can find it. If that makes you gasp, you'll enjoy this episode.

About This Show

Created by Compass Digital Strategies, the Small Business Marketing Sweet Spot offers an eclectic mix of episodes, all meant to help you find the sweet spot in your business. Each week, you'll hear the what, why, and how's of getting more visibility on your website for the goal of more traffic and leads, along with bonus episodes, some experiential from other business owners sharing their own sweet spot.

We talk about everything that influences creating an atmosphere around and inside you that you actually love because how you grow your business and how you move through your life are connected, and neither of them are linear.
